Transaction 7c5265a8cc14f66a7f2010609d6bf1c4d9114e60265f5cf16bae1911b38833a3
1 Input
1 Output
-
7c5265a8cc14f66a7f2010609d6bf1c4d9114e60265f5cf16bae1911b38833a3:0
- value
- 898882880
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cae8e74c5605348aaa27d2a98d9d3e4054771a8b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KVtWApEwu4zQaF8BSTxxcKnL1qq6aW5MC